Output 93af57c1797e95b2cc8cd4899a8867d4de77efe7a456f523ee97e636c7b8a050:0

value
38579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e77b884cc673061e555b0f22dad268fc69c565f8 OP_EQUAL
address
3Nnz13FoXmrEkznXehk3kgvpLeqyXgFBmc
transaction
93af57c1797e95b2cc8cd4899a8867d4de77efe7a456f523ee97e636c7b8a050
confirmations
86779
spent
true